SIR WILLIAM LAWRENCE (1783-1867) A treatise on ruptures. Printed for J. Callow 1810 2nd ed. xiii, 484 pp., 2 plates (1 fold.). 21.5 cm.

Although Lawrence was best known as an eye surgeon whose practice was centered on St. Bartholomew's Hospital in London, he also contributed significantly to the understanding and management of ruptures. The present work, first published in 1807 as A treatise on hernia, remained for many years the standard work on the subject.
